Ao Nuan, Ko Samet

BEACH
Ao Nuan is less than a 10-minute walk from the Ao Tubtim. It is a small bay with a narrow strip of white fine sand and only a few people around. Swimming here is pleasant, since the waves are not high and the water is crystal clear.

Grab one of the beach chairs, put it under one of the beautiful trees along the water and relax. It is a good spot on Ko Samet for more solitary beachgoers. Despite not being far from the busier bays, this place feels like you are in the middle of nature.

WHERE TO STAY
Nuan Bungalow offers a range of accommodations, from simple bamboo bungalows with shared bathrooms to nice wooden bungalows with air conditioning. Just up the hill, Noina’s Mystic Mountain offers some simple bungalows. You can also rent a tent for 400 baht or do yoga as an extra activity.

Although both places have a restaurant, you can also just walk to one of the other beaches.
